Talking Social Business 011 - Essential copyright tips for social media marketing communications and online PR

In this episode, we cover our review of social media and technology legal news and talk about the the important issue of copyright when it comes to social media communications.

I am joined by employment and social media lawyer Kevin Poulter and we share practical advice you can use in your organisation.

Note: due to unforseen personal circumstances this episode was not posted at the time of recording so some of the news are a from several weeks ago.

Talking Social Business Episode 011 Show Notes

00:00 Introduction to this episode
00:59 Social media news to pay attention to
08:44 An employee is dismissed after posting they were taking drugs while in company uniform and posted this to Snapchat
14:25 A teen is caught sharing content on Snapchat when driving
21:45 Essential copyright tips for social media communications
64:25 How to get in contact with us
65:52 A simple tool to watermark your images
69:30 How to leave your feedback and suggestions
71:01 Show ends
